Output 407ac8567a299ad66436983bb3c86780607e46a265ded71433294adf62c71ddc:22

value
2987443
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2a87b88bdc3433474e5f6230a12b912c6f5d5f20 OP_EQUALVERIFY OP_CHECKSIG
address
14ssy7LS2iVXbtAxwgYhLUPGqZscBoZfHb
transaction
407ac8567a299ad66436983bb3c86780607e46a265ded71433294adf62c71ddc
spent
true